
Virtual Dance Cinema – EP#9: Concrete Flow – Urban Dance Experience
Concrete Flow is a cinematic dance piece rooted in urban movement and street-born expression.
Set against the raw textures of the city, this episode captures the tension, rhythm, and energy that emerge where body meets concrete.
The dancer moves with precision and instinct — sharp accents collide with fluid transitions, grounded steps shift into sudden releases. Each gesture reflects the dynamics of urban life: pressure, momentum, resilience, and self-assertion. The choreography feels immediate and alive, shaped by rhythm rather than rules.
Visually, the film draws from modern architecture and industrial surroundings. Clean lines, open spaces, and natural light frame the movement, while dynamic camera work follows the dancer closely, emphasizing physicality, weight, and timing. The city is not just a backdrop — it actively shapes the dance.
